About agriculture in Sanlúcar de Guadiana
Sanlúcar de Guadiana is a picturesque village situated on the eastern bank of the Guadiana River in the province of Huelva, Andalusia. Directly facing Portugal, the settlement is surrounded by the rolling hills of the Andévalo region, characterized by its Mediterranean scrubland and riverside landscapes. The rural area features a mix of traditional terrace farming and vast expanses of rugged terrain typical of the Spanish-Portuguese borderlands.
Agriculture in the vicinity is dominated by olive groves and citrus plantations that benefit from the proximity to the river. The region is also known for its extensive "dehesa" landscapes, where cork oaks provide a habitat for livestock, particularly Iberian pigs and sheep. Small-scale vegetable production and traditional dry-land farming of cereals continue to be essential components of the local rural economy.
